Actors Billy Boyd, Craig Parker, and John Rhys-Davies captivated Dragon*Con yesterday with their enchanting accents and witty repartee as they hosted a panel at the Atlanta convention. Debbie Yutko writes:
“When asked about Peter Jackson’s upcoming film The Hobbit, all three actors agreed that it will be epic. Rhys-Davies predicted that The Hobbit will be a game-changer. ‘You’re going to see one of the greatest films of all time—soon,’ he said to rousing cheers and applause. He predicted that a lot more awards will be coming Peter Jackson’s way.”

We revealed in July during HobbitCon 2012 that pre-sales for The Bridge Direct’s line of figures from Peter Jackson’s The Hobbit trilogy would begin in September. Well, today is the day fans can start pre-ordering for the figures representing the characters from the first film in the trilogy.
The figures in The Bridge Direct’s range will vary in scale from 3.75″ figures to 6″ figures, and come in two-packs, battle packs, and deluxe figures. Check out Amazon.Com, ToysRUS.com, and EntertainmentEarth.com to get your online orders in now.

As you undoubtedly know by our grand adventure across the country, TheOneRing.net is set to invade Dragon*Con , the world’s largest Sci-Fi/Pop Culture convention, this Labor Day weekend (August 31st – September 3rd) in Atlanta, Georgia.
This years LotR/Hobbit guests feature a star-studded line-up: Billy Boyd, John Rhys-Davies, Craig Parker, and Sylvester McCoy.
Meet up with other Tolkien fans at the annual Evening at Bree event on Friday August 31st, hosted by Tolkien’s Middle-earth Track with music by Emerald Rose and a costume contest MC’d by Craig Parker. The Tolkien Track will also host fan film screenings, costuming panels, scholarly discussions, even open mic nights! One of our very favorite magazines and supporter of our Road to DragonCon Adventure, EMPIRE Magazine, has published their ‘The Hobbit: An Unexpected Journey’ edition and it is quite impressive! This special edition of the magazine features a detailing of their set visit in New Zealand, with a special focus on Gollum and Bilbo’s ‘Riddles in the Dark’ sequence. In addition to some big stars from The Lord of the Rings and The Hobbit, DragonCon this year will also feature the little star authors of Nimpentoad, a children’s fantasy book. The furry bright-eyed little Nimpentoad is tired of being picked on by the bigger and meaner creatures of the ancient shadowy Grunwald Forest. He convinces his fellow Niblings to make the perilous journey to a castle where they hope to find refuge. Along the way, they are confronted by ravenous goblins, trolls, rhinotaurs, and other perils. But with teamwork and Nimpentoad’s leadership, the Niblings outwit these menaces.
